Low budget indie horror can always be a gamble, especially horror comedy, but Slice? It actually pays off.
Frankly, it is worth it just to watch Gregory Alan Williams chew the scenery and steal every scene they are in.
Writer/Director/Actor Pierre Edwards also delivers a solid performance that is definitely loads of fun. Far too often, in cases like that, the entire film suffers from the split attention, but here? It works.
The rest of the acting is a bit hit or miss, as one might expect, but this is a fun little film that punches above its weight class.
Now, this isn't a film that will become a genre classic. It isn't Citizen Kane or the like, but if you go into it with a full understanding that this is a low budget, indie film, I think you will be quite presently surprised.
